Transaction 43d46282ead269028641537e312986ba6331810c02a56b7761e2ac056803f957
1 Input
2 Outputs
- 43d46282ead269028641537e312986ba6331810c02a56b7761e2ac056803f957:0
- 43d46282ead269028641537e312986ba6331810c02a56b7761e2ac056803f957:1
value 139887
address 1KU7AngjpRJmbopLhEP8wK3BmRYMS7jtJz
value 734416
address 1LAEknVBdWBgpX7MPhBQjij7JdhjJ6R5mM